Gait Patient Transfer Belt

The OTC 2466 gait belt is a safety device used for moving a person from one place to another. The belt is also used to help hold up a weak person while they walk. Putting this belt around a person's waist allows helpers to grip it and keep the person from falling. It also decreases the chance of a helper hurting his back while helping a person move or walk.

Use For: Used for moving a person with balance problems from one place to another; to assist a person with balance problems in walking
